Q: Is 2,649,846 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,649,846 is a composite number.

Why is 2,649,846 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,649,846 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 29 58 87 97 157 174 194 291 314 471 582 942 2,813 4,553 5,626 8,439 9,106 13,659 15,229 16,878 27,318 30,458 45,687 91,374 441,641 883,282 1,324,923 and 2,649,846, with no remainder.

Since 2,649,846 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,649,846, it is a composite number.
